VS软件添加备份数据库教程
vs怎么将备份数据库添加进来

首页 2025-03-31 23:17:58



VS中如何高效地将备份数据库添加进来 在软件开发过程中,数据库的管理和维护是至关重要的环节

    无论是进行版本迭代、数据迁移还是灾难恢复,备份数据库的导入都显得尤为关键

    Visual Studio(简称VS)作为一款强大的集成开发环境,提供了多种便捷的工具和方法来导入备份数据库

    本文将详细介绍如何在VS中高效地将备份数据库添加进来,确保数据的完整性和操作的简便性

     一、准备工作 在正式导入备份数据库之前,需要做好以下准备工作: 1.确认备份数据库文件:确保你已经拥有需要导入的备份数据库文件,如.bak文件或其他支持的数据库备份格式

     2.安装必要的组件:根据你所使用的数据库类型(如SQL Server、MySQL等),确保VS已经安装了相应的数据库连接组件

     3.配置数据库连接:在VS中,通过“服务器资源管理器”或“SQL Server对象资源管理器”配置好数据库连接,确保能够顺利连接到目标数据库服务器

     二、使用“服务器资源管理器”导入备份数据库 “服务器资源管理器”是VS中一个非常实用的工具,它允许你连接到数据库服务器并管理数据库资源

    以下是使用“服务器资源管理器”导入备份数据库的详细步骤: 1.打开Visual Studio:启动VS并打开你的项目

     2.打开“服务器资源管理器”:在VS的菜单栏中,点击“视图”->“服务器资源管理器”,打开“服务器资源管理器”窗口

     3.添加数据库连接:在“服务器资源管理器”中,右键点击“数据连接”节点,选择“添加连接”

    在弹出的“添加连接”对话框中,选择你的数据库类型(如SQL Server),并输入相应的服务器名称、数据库名称和登录凭据

    点击“测试连接”按钮,确保连接成功

     4.导入备份数据库:在成功连接到数据库服务器后,右键点击目标数据库节点(或你想要导入备份数据库的位置),选择“任务”->“还原”->“数据库”

    在弹出的“还原数据库”向导中,选择你的备份文件(.bak文件),并根据向导的提示完成还原过程

     - 注意:在某些版本的VS或SQL Server中,可能找不到直接的“还原”选项

    此时,你可以通过SQL Server Management Studio(SSMS)等其他数据库管理工具来还原备份数据库,然后再在VS中刷新数据库连接以显示新还原的数据库

     5.验证导入结果:导入完成后,在“服务器资源管理器”中刷新数据库连接,确保新导入的数据库已经正确显示

    同时,可以通过查询数据来验证导入的数据是否完整和正确

     三、使用“SQL Server对象资源管理器”导入备份数据库 对于管理SQL Server数据库的用户来说,“SQL Server对象资源管理器”提供了更加专业的功能

    以下是使用“SQL Server对象资源管理器”导入备份数据库的步骤: 1.打开“SQL Server对象资源管理器”:在VS的菜单栏中,点击“视图”->“SQL Server对象资源管理器”,打开“SQL Server对象资源管理器”窗口

     2.连接到SQL Server实例:在“SQL Server对象资源管理器”中,点击“连接到SQL Server”按钮,输入你的SQL Server实例名称和登录凭据,点击“连接”

     3.还原备份数据库:成功连接到SQL Server实例后,右键点击“数据库”节点,选择“还原数据库”

    在弹出的“还原数据库”对话框中,选择你的备份文件(.bak文件),并根据向导的提示完成还原过程

    与“服务器资源管理器”类似,你也可以通过SSMS等其他工具来还原备份数据库

     4.刷新并验证:在“SQL Server对象资源管理器”中刷新数据库列表,确保新还原的数据库已经显示

    通过执行查询来验证数据的完整性和正确性

     四、注意事项与常见问题排查 在导入备份数据库的过程中,可能会遇到一些常见问题

    以下是一些注意事项和排查方法: 1.数据库文件格式兼容性问题:确保你的备份数据库文件格式与VS和SQL Server的版本兼容

    不同版本的SQL Server可能支持不同的备份文件格式

     2.数据库连接失败:如果连接数据库时失败,请检查以下几点: SQL Server服务是否已经启动

     数据库连接字符串是否正确

     登录凭据是否有足够的权限

     3.数据不完整或丢失:在导入备份数据库后,务必进行数据校验,确保所有数据都已正确导入

    如果发现数据丢失或不完整,可以尝试重新导入备份文件,并检查导入过程中的日志信息以查找问题原因

     4.VS崩溃或性能问题:如果VS在导入过程中崩溃或性能下降,可能是由于内存不足或数据库文件过大导致

    尝试关闭其他不必要的程序,释放内存资源,或者分批次导入数据

     5.权限问题:确保你有足够的权限来执行数据库导入操作

    如果权限不足,请联系数据库管理员获取相应的权限

     五、高级技巧与最佳实践 除了基本的导入操作外,以下是一些高级技巧和最佳实践,可以帮助你更高效地管理数据库: 1.使用版本控制系统:将数据库脚本和备份文件纳入版本控制系统,以便跟踪数据库的变化并进行版本管理

    这有助于在团队协作中避免数据冲突和丢失

     2.定期备份数据库:定期备份数据库是防止数据丢失的重要措施

    建议制定备份策略,并定期执行备份操作

    同时,将备份文件存储在安全可靠的位置

     3.自动化导入过程:通过编写脚本或使用自动化工具来简化数据库导入过程

    这可以提高工作效率,并减少人为错误的可能性

    例如,可以使用PowerShell脚本或SQL Server代理作业来自动化备份和还原操作

     4.监控数据库性能:在导入备份数据库后,监控数据库的性能指标,如CPU使用率、内存占用、I/O性能等

    这有助于及时发现并解决性能问题,确保数据库的稳定运行

     5.学习和利用社区资源:VS和SQL Server拥有庞大的用户社区和丰富的在线资源

    在遇到问题时,可以利用社区论坛、官方文档和在线教程来查找解决方案

    同时,积极参与社区讨论和分享经验也是提升技能的好方法

     六、总结 将备份数据库导入VS是软件开发过程中不可或缺的一步

    通过本文介绍的详细步骤和注意事项,你可以高效地完成这一任务,并确保数据的完整性和操作的简便性

    同时,利用高级技巧和最佳实践可以进一步提升你的数据库管理能力

    无论你是初学者还是经验丰富的开发者,掌握这些技能都将对你的软件开发工作产生积极的影响

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道